Hansen's Café

Hansen's Café Review

This intimate restaurant, in a National Trust building constructed in 1783, is just steps from the harbor. The Danish art hanging from the timber walls provides a cozy ambience for a casual crowd that often lingers for drinks well after dinner. The daily menu is short but provides a taste of what's fresh—especially seafood. Try the lumpfish roe for a tasty local treat. Business hours vary so it's wise to call in advance.
